Ukrainian Red Cross Society warns about fake messages about money payments
The Ukrainian Red Cross Society (URCS) is warning people about fake information circulating about alleged money payments from the organization.
"Fake information about alleged payments from the Ukrainian Red Cross Society is spreading again on the Internet. This time, scammers are using a new date — October 26 — and promising a payment of UAH 9,600 to those Ukrainians who have not traveled abroad in the last six months. We emphasize that the Ukrainian Red Cross Society has not published such ads," the URCS reported on Facebook on Tuesday.
The URCS reminded that it does not carry out any registrations through third-party sites or platforms. Such messages are intended to mislead people and obtain their personal data or money.
"All reliable information about assistance programs is published only on the organization's official resources, in particular, on the website redcross.org.ua and on the organization's official social media pages," the Ukrainian Red Cross Society emphasized.
